2017 GSX-R1K S2B: Episode 4 - Exhaust Installation and Theory (Part 2) Standard vs. 'R' Version - Brock continues the discussion on OEM exhaust systems and their function and analyzes restrictions as well as potential cures. He enlists the help of 650ib’s buddy, Luke, slip-on clad GSX-R1000 ‘R’ to help answer some of the questions posted in Part 1 as well as putting to bed the question, “Is the R version more powerful than the standard version?”

Once again, he gets down and dirty to make the discussion as fun and enjoyable as possible.

The details :

Brock’s Performance 2017 GSX-R1000L7 Standard model (not the ‘R’ version)
Traction control – Motion Track Traction Control Standard (TC=OFF during testing)
Suzuki Drive Mode Selector (S-DMS) Power Mode=A (max power selected during testing)

Fuel used during test: Shell 89 Octane (choices available at our local Shell are 87, 89, 93 octane – we selected mid-grade for our tests)
Rear tire: Stock Bridgestone Battlax RS10 190/55/ZR17 – 35 PSI Nitrogen
Motor oil: As delivered (unknown)
Air filter: OEM
PAIR: Blocked
Power Commander: On bike with ZERO map installed (equivalent to no Power Commander at all)
ECU: Stock
5th gear pulls

Luke’s (GixxerGuy’s) 2017 GSX-R1000R
Traction control – Motion Track Traction Control Standard (TC=OFF during testing)
Suzuki Drive Mode Selector (S-DMS) Power Mode=A (max power selected during testing)
Fuel used during test: Premium from Sheetz Convenience Store (Akron, OH area)
Rear tire: Stock Bridgestone Battlax RS10 190/55/ZR17 – 35 PSI Nitrogen
Motor oil: Suzuki ECSTAR 10W40
Air filter: OEM
PAIR: Blocked
Power Commander: None
ECU: Stock
5th Gear Pulls


Dynojet Model 250I dyno using DynoWare RT and WinPep 8 dyno control - displaying the SAE scale (unless noted otherwise in video)

Video Introduction – Thanks to our GOOD BUDDY, 650Ib, and our new friend, Luke (GixxerGuy,) we have a 2017 GSX-R1000R with a beautiful Yosh slip-on exhaust to test/compare to our standard version 2017 Gixxer. Let’s find out WHICH ONE IS FASTER!!

2:00 Standard mode base runs (ALWAYS same time/day to test the power output for the days atmospheric conditions)

2:25 R model base runs. Quick shifter and auto blipper are incredibly smooth and seamless!

3:30 Standard vs. R model base run discussion

5:55 What did we just learn? The R model has MANY advantages over the standard… additional power just isn’t one of them 

7:30 Does the damn EXUP valve actually make more low end power?! Check out this trickness we set up in Dynojet’s WinPep 8 software to help figure it out.

8:45 More base runs. We can’t get enough.

9:10 Disconnect EXUP (Suzuki SET) cables and run again

10:25 EXUP run discussion

12:40 Real time horsepower and torque tests of the EXUP valve (Suzuki SET). Is it there for low end gains or noise control?

15:50 Results discussion. WHY does the OEM exhaust work the way it does?

About YouTube 📺

YouTube, an American video-sharing website based in San Bruno, California, offers a diverse range of user-generated and corporate media content. 🌟

Content and Users 🎵

Users can upload, view, rate, share, and comment on videos, with content spanning video clips, music videos, live streams, and more.

While most content is uploaded by individuals, media corporations like CBS and the BBC also contribute. Unregistered users can watch videos, while registered users enjoy additional privileges such as uploading unlimited videos and adding comments.

Monetization and Impact 🤑

YouTube and creators earn revenue through Google AdSense, with most videos free to view. Premium channels and subscription services like YouTube Music and YouTube Premium offer ad-free streaming.

As of February 2017, over 400 hours of content were uploaded to YouTube every minute, with the site ranking as the second-most popular globally. By May 2019, this figure exceeded 500 hours per minute. 📈
